Interventional,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led, optional open-label extension trial of LU AF82422 in participants with multiple system atrophy

The purpose of this clinical trial is to find out whether a potential new treatment, the trial drug, Lu AF82422, is safe and effective in people living with MSA.

This trial will compare the effects of the trial drug, Lu AF82422, to placebo (inactive medication). Both the trial drug and placebo will be given as an infusion. Researchers use a placebo to see if a trial drug works better or is safer than not taking anything at all. The main question the researchers want to answer is: Will treatment with Lu AF82422 slow the progression of MSA disease over time?
